How should I use Drizalma?

Take this medicine by mouth with a glass of water. Follow the directions on the prescription label. Do not crush, cut or chew some capsules of this medicine. Some capsules may be opened and sprinkled on applesauce. Check with your doctor or pharmacist if you are not sure. You can take this medicine with or without food. Take your medicine at regular intervals. Do not take your medicine more often than directed. Do not stop taking this medicine suddenly except upon the advice of your doctor. Stopping this medicine too quickly may cause serious side effects or your condition may worsen.

A special MedGuide will be given to you by the pharmacist with each prescription and refill. Be sure to read this information carefully each time.

Talk to your pediatrician regarding the use of this medicine in children. While this drug may be prescribed for children as young as 7 years of age for selected conditions, precautions do apply.

Overdosage: If you think you have taken too much of Drizalma contact a poison control center or emergency room at once. NOTE: Drizalma is only for you. Do not share Drizalma with others.

What if I miss a dose?

If you miss a dose, take it as soon as you can. If it is almost time for your next dose, take only that dose. Do not take double or extra doses.
